Uncommitted. Stands in at a physical 5-foot-9 with some present strength throughout his frame. He worked a clean inning in relief for the Spartans with a three-pitch mix. His fastball had life through the zone at 85-87 mph (T88). He showed a 70 mph changeup that he could throw for strikes, while tossing in an 11/5-shaped breaking ball at 67 mph that showed swing and miss potential.

The right-hander ran his fastball up to 81.7 mph and also flipped in a sharp curveball 11/5 at 62-65 mph and changeup at 68-70 mph. His delivery is athletic, utilizing a drop/drive lower-half to create power, also remaining in-line with the plate throughout. He also took a notable round of BP, swinging with controlled aggression and intent from the right-side of the plate. He has athletic hands, creates bat speed and utilizes a gap-to-gap approach with 70% of his swings resulting in fly balls.

Positional Profile: 3B/RHP Body: 5-9, 160-pounds. Athletic frame, round shoulders. Delivery: Athletic delivery, high leg-kick, drop/drive lower-half, remains in-line to the plate, front foot lands square. Arm Action: RH. Long arm out of the glove, high 3/4 slot. FB: T81.7, 80-82 mph. Life out of the hand, slight sinking action. T2149, 2101 average rpm. CB: 63-65 mph. Sharp 11/5 shape. T1683, 1616 average rpm. CH: 68-70 mph. Slight fade to the arm-side. T1499, 1398 average rpm.
Hit: RHH. Confident balanced setup, toe-tap stride. Swings with controlled aggression and intent. Athletic hands, creates bat speed, gap-to-gap approach. Power: 90 max exit velocity, averaged 73.1 mph. 281’ max distance. Arm: RH. INF - 81 mph. Long arm circle, 3/4 slot. Defense: Gets behind and around the baseball, flashes actions, steady hands and clean release. Run: 7.46 runner in the 60.
